Transaction 1f58eb146201bb335c68a347821c14931aa1ae5b9f571e89a8e1f13721830a75
1 Input
1 Output
-
1f58eb146201bb335c68a347821c14931aa1ae5b9f571e89a8e1f13721830a75:0
- value
- 708524
- script pubkey
- OP_0 OP_PUSHBYTES_20 84122bd02bd46cc4f5382d108f4a55a9bb890e0e
- address
- bc1qssfzh5pt63kvfafc95gg7jj44xacjrsw0g72qa